Background Information
CxORF56 (also known as STEEP) is an evolutionarily highly conserved protein whose function is unknown. Recently CxORF56 has been identified as a protein that interacts with STING, and it is essential for STING ER exit. CxORF56-dependent STING ER exit is essential for STING signaling in antiviral defense and in inflammatory diseases.
